Abstract
La presente invención se relaciona con un laringoscopio de ventilación por inyección de alta frecuencia controlado electrónicamente, el cual incluye el mango de laringoscopio y la hoja de laringoscopio; dentro del mango de laringoscopio está dispuesto un tubo de suministro de oxígeno, el extremo frontal del tubo de suministro de oxígeno está colocado en el extremo frontal de la hoja de laringoscopio. El laringoscopio también incluye un controlador electrónico que consta de una carcasa, una pantalla de visualización, una válvula solenoide, un módulo de suministro de energía, un módulo de control y un interruptor de control. La carcasa está fija a la parte superior del mango de laringoscopio; la pantalla de visualización y el interruptor de control están dispuestos en la carcasa; el módulo de suministro de energía y el módulo de control están dispuestos dentro de la carcasa; la válvula solenoide está dispuesta en el tubo de suministro de oxígeno dentro del mango de laringoscopio; la pantalla de visualización, el módulo de control y el interruptor de control están conectados con el módulo de suministro de energía; y el módulo de control está conectado con la pantalla de visualización y la válvula solenoide, respectivamente. Ventajas: el suministro de oxígeno se lleva a cabo mediante ventilación por inyección de alta frecuencia a través de un proceso de control automático electrónico, durante la intubación de la tráquea en la reanimación pulmonar en el ser humano, con el fin de tratar de inmediato a pacientes en estado crítico. El laringoscopio con alimentación de energía propia, es compacto y flexible, portátil, simple de manejar y su uso es preciso y confiable, por lo tanto, es adecuado para reanimación, en sitio, en varias situaciones que implican maniobras con el paciente.
